IMPORTANT PROCEDURAL UPDATE: I just found out that we must not specifically mention the Aragon or any other development project (per guidance from the Saanich Legislative Committee Clerk).

 

If you mention a specific project, your letter will not be included in the official agenda package. Your email must be general in nature. While the Mayor and Council will still receive your email, it will not be part of the official public record for this motion.

Why this matters: Right now, developments are moving through the "black box" of staff review. With the new Provincial rules, we are at risk of losing our right to a Public Hearing. The Chambers Motion is our best chance to fix this. If it passes, it forces Saanich to create a formal way for us to have a say, regardless of what the Province says.
